怎么更修改远程端口 - 如何高效修改远程端口,提升网络安全性与通信效率,保障数据传输安全无忧!

首页 2024-06-25 18:01:20



远程端口修改的专业方法与步骤 在计算机网络领域,远程端口的修改是一项重要的安全配置工作,它关系到服务器与客户端之间的通信安全以及服务的可用性

    本文将详细阐述如何更修改远程端口,包括修改前的准备工作、具体的修改步骤以及修改后的验证与注意事项,旨在为读者提供一套完整且专业的远程端口修改方案

     一、修改远程端口前的准备工作 在进行远程端口修改之前,必须做好充分的准备工作,以确保修改的顺利进行以及服务的连续性

     1. 了解当前端口使用情况:首先,需要明确当前远程端口的使用情况,包括哪些服务正在使用该端口、端口的通信协议以及端口的开放状态等

    这可以通过查看服务器的网络配置、防火墙规则以及服务配置文件来实现

     2. 备份配置文件:在进行任何配置修改之前,都应该先备份相关的配置文件

    这样,在修改过程中出现问题时,可以快速恢复到原始状态,避免服务中断或数据丢失

     3. 规划新的端口号:根据实际需要和安全策略,选择一个合适的远程端口号

    新的端口号应避免与其他服务冲突,同时考虑到端口的易用性和记忆性

     二、修改远程端口的步骤 下面以常见的SSH服务为例,介绍如何修改远程端口

     1. 编辑SSH配置文件:SSH服务的配置文件通常位于/etc/ssh/sshd_config

    使用文本编辑器(如vi、nano等)打开该文件

     2. 查找并修改端口号:在配置文件中,找到Port配置项,该配置项定义了SSH服务的监听端口

    将其修改为新的端口号,例如Port 2222

    如果需要同时监听多个端口,可以在同一行使用空格分隔多个端口号,或者添加多行Port配置项

     3. 保存并退出编辑器:在vi编辑器中,按Esc键退出编辑模式,然后输入:wq保存并退出;在nano编辑器中,按Ctrl + O保存文件,然后按Ctrl + X退出编辑器

     4. 重启SSH服务:修改配置文件后,需要重启SSH服务以使更改生效

    使用适当的命令(如systemctl restart sshd或/etc/init.d/sshd restart)重启SSH服务

     三、修改后的验证与注意事项 完成远程端口的修改后,需要进行验证以确保修改成功,并注意一些可能的问题

     1. 验证端口修改是否成功:可以使用netstat命令或ss命令查看SSH服务是否在新的端口上监听

    例如,执行netstat -tuln | grep sshd或ss -tuln | grep sshd命令,检查输出中是否包含新的端口号

     2. 测试远程连接:使用SSH客户端尝试连接到新的远程端口,确保能够成功连接并正常通信

    如果连接失败,应检查防火墙规则是否允许通过新的端口、SSH服务是否正常运行以及配置文件是否存在错误等

     3. 更新防火墙规则:如果服务器使用了防火墙,需要确保防火墙规则允许通过新的远程端口

    根据使用的防火墙软件不同,具体的配置方法可能有所差异

     4. 通知相关用户:远程端口修改后,需要及时通知所有需要远程访问该服务的用户,以便他们更新连接信息

     四、总结 远程端口的修改是一项涉及网络配置和安全性的重要工作

    通过本文的介绍,读者应该能够了解远程端口修改的基本步骤和注意事项,从而在实际操作中更加熟练地进行远程端口的修改和管理

    同时,也提醒读者在进行任何配置修改时都应谨慎操作,确保服务的连续性和安全性

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道